返回首页

jquery获取radio值

73 2024-10-05 01:44 admin

一、jquery获取radio值

如何使用jQuery获取radio按钮的值

在网页开发中,有时会遇到需要获取用户选择的radio按钮的值的情况。使用jQuery可以轻松地实现这一功能,让我们来看看如何利用jQuery获取radio按钮的值。

首先,我们需要确保在页面中引入jQuery库,可以通过以下代码在文件中引入jQuery:

接下来,我们假设页面中有一组radio按钮,类名为radio-btn,我们想要获取用户选择的值。我们可以使用以下代码来实现:

$(document).ready(function() {
    $('.radio-btn').change(function() {
        var selectedValue = $('input[name="radio-btn"]:checked').val();
        console.log(selectedValue);
    });
});

在上面的代码中,$('.radio-btn')选择了所有类名为radio-btn的radio按钮元素,.change()函数用于监听值的变化。在函数内部,我们使用$('input[name="radio-btn"]:checked')来选择被选中的radio按钮元素,再通过.val()方法获取其值,并将其打印到控制台中。

如果要将获取到的值显示在页面上,可以将其赋值给另一个元素的文本内容,例如:

$(document).ready(function() {
    $('.radio-btn').change(function() {
        var selectedValue = $('input[name="radio-btn"]:checked').val();
        $('#selected-value').text(selectedValue);
    });
});

在上面的代码中,假设页面中有一个ID为selected-value的元素,我们将获取的值通过.text()方法赋给这个元素,这样就可以在页面上显示用户选择的值了。

除了使用.val()方法获取radio按钮的值外,还可以使用.attr('value')方法来实现,如下所示:

$(document).ready(function() {
    $('.radio-btn').change(function() {
        var selectedValue = $('input[name="radio-btn"]:checked').attr('value');
        console.log(selectedValue);
    });
});

上面代码中,.attr('value')方法与.val()方法的作用一样,都是获取radio按钮的值,可以根据个人喜好来选择使用哪种方法。

总的来说,通过使用jQuery来获取radio按钮的值是一种简单而有效的方式,可以让用户在页面上作出选择并及时获取其输入的数值。希望以上方法对您有所帮助!

二、jquery 获取radio值

jQuery 获取radio值

在前端页面开发中,经常会遇到需要获取用户选择的`radio`按钮的值的情况。使用jQuery来实现这个功能非常方便,下面将介绍如何通过jQuery获取`radio`按钮的值。

示例:

假设有如下代码:

<input type="radio" name="gender" value="male"> 男 <input type="radio" name="gender" value="female"> 女

现在我们想要获取用户选择的性别值,可以使用如下的jQuery代码:

$(document).ready(function() {
    $('input[name=gender]:checked').val();
});

上述代码中,`$('input[name=gender]:checked')` 用来选择被选中的`radio`按钮,`.val()` 方法用来获取选择的值。

实现:

要实现获取`radio`按钮的值,首先需要确保页面已经加载完成,这样才能正确捕获用户的选择。因此,我们使用`$(document).ready()` 来包裹代码,确保在页面加载完成后执行。

接着使用选择器`$('input[name=gender]:checked')`来选中被选中的`radio`按钮,然后调用`.val()` 方法来获取选中的值。

注意事项:

  • 确保`radio`按钮有相同的`name`属性,这样才能保证在同一组内只能选择一个选项。
  • 使用`:checked`伪类来选择被选中的`radio`按钮。

总结:

通过使用jQuery,可以轻松地获取用户选择的`radio`按钮的值,从而实现前端页面开发中常见的需求。准确使用选择器和方法,可以让代码更加简洁高效,提高开发效率。

希望本篇文章对您有所帮助,谢谢阅读!

三、jquery 获取radio的值

jQuery获取radio的值

在前端开发中,经常会遇到需要操作表单元素的情况。其中,获取radio按钮的值是一个常见的需求。使用jQuery可以轻松实现这一功能。本文将介绍如何利用jQuery获取radio按钮的值。

一、基本概念

在表单中,radio按钮允许用户在一组选项中选择一个。每个radio按钮都有一个值,用户只能选择其中之一。通常这些radio按钮是作为一组出现的。

二、jQuery方法

要获取radio按钮的值,可以使用jQuery提供的方法。在jQuery中,可以通过选择器选取需要操作的元素,然后调用相应的方法来实现获取值的功能。

三、示例代码

下面是一个简单的示例代码,演示如何使用jQuery获取radio按钮的值:

$('input[name=radioName]:checked').val();

四、代码解析

在上面的代码中,首先使用选择器选取name属性为“radioName”的radio按钮组,然后调用:checked筛选出被选中的radio按钮,最后使用.val()方法获取选中按钮的值。

五、注意事项

在实际开发中,需要注意一些细节问题。例如,确保选择器能够准确地选取到需要获取值的radio按钮,避免出现值获取不准确的情况。

六、总结

通过本文的介绍,相信读者已经了解了如何利用jQuery获取radio按钮的值。这是一个简单而实用的技巧,在实际开发中能够帮助开发者更好地处理表单数据。掌握这一技能,可以提高前端开发效率,为用户提供更加友好和智能的交互体验。

四、php如何获取input值?

只有提交form表单之后,才能取得input的value值。 如: 取值 $_POST['username']

五、php 获取form值

在PHP开发过程中,获取表单数值是一项常见且关键的任务。无论是从用户提交的表单中获取数据还是从其他来源读取信息,确保准确获取并处理这些数值至关重要。本文将深入探讨PHP中获取表单数值的方法,并提供一些最佳实践建议。

PHP中的表单数值获取

在PHP中获取表单数值通常涉及使用超全局数组$_POST或$_GET。这两种数组包含了通过HTTP POST或HTTP GET方法发送到当前脚本的所有表单值。要获取特定表单字段的值,只需访问相应的数组键即可。

比如,如果想要获取名为"username"的文本框的值,可以使用以下语法:

<?php $用户名 = $_POST['用户名']; ?>

通过这种方式,可以轻松地从表单中提取需要的数据,以便在后续的PHP脚本中进行处理和存储。

获取表单值的最佳实践

在获取表单数值时,有几个最佳实践可以帮助确保代码的安全性和可靠性。

  • 永远不要相信用户输入,始终对获取的数据进行验证和清理。
  • 使用过滤器函数或正则表达式验证表单值的格式。
  • 在接收表单数据前,确保对其进行适当的验证和过滤,以防止潜在的安全漏洞。
  • 避免直接将表单值用于数据库查询或输出到浏览器,而应该使用预处理语句和适当的转义。

遵循这些最佳实践可以有效地防止常见的安全风险,如SQL注入和跨站点脚本攻击,从而保护您的应用程序和用户数据。

处理复杂表单数据

在实际开发中,表单数据可能会比简单的文本框和选择框更复杂,例如文件上传、多复选框选择等。针对这些情况,PHP提供了各种方法来处理和获取这些复杂表单数据。

对于文件上传,可以使用$_FILES超全局数组来访问上传的文件,获取文件名、类型、大小等信息。通过适当的文件处理函数,可以轻松地将上传的文件保存到服务器指定位置。

对于多复选框选择,表单数据以数组的形式提交,您可以使用foreach循环或array_map函数来遍历这些数据,并对其进行处理。

结论

在PHP开发中,正确获取和处理表单数值是非常重要的一部分。通过使用$_POST和$_GET超全局数组,以及遵循最佳实践和安全性建议,您可以有效地获取用户提交的数据,并确保应用程序的稳定性和安全性。

希望本文介绍的方法和建议能帮助您更好地处理表单数值,并在PHP开发中取得成功。

六、php 获取传值

在网站开发中,PHP 获取传值 是一个非常常见且重要的操作。无论是用户输入的数据、表单提交的信息还是其他页面传递的数据,都需要通过 PHP 来获取并处理这些传值。在本文中,我们将详细探讨 PHP 中如何获取不同方式传递的数值,并给出相应的实例。

通过 URL 传值

通过 URL 传值是最常见的方式之一。当用户点击链接跳转到另一个页面时,往往需要在 URL 中传递一些参数。在 PHP 中,可以使用 $_GET 数组来获取这些通过 URL 传递的数值。例如:

通过表单传值

另一种常见的方式是通过表单提交传递数值。用户在前端页面填写表单信息后,通过 POST 或者 GET 方法提交到后端处理。在 PHP 中,可以使用 $_POST 或者 $_GET 数组来获取表单中提交的数值。例如:

通过 Session 传值

有时候需要在不同页面之间传递数值,这时可以使用 Session。在 PHP 中,可以使用 $_SESSION 超全局变量来存储和获取 Session 中的数值。例如:

通过 Cookie 传值

类似于 Session,Cookie 也可以用来在不同页面之间传递数值。不过 Cookie 是存储在用户本地的,通过 HTTP 头部传递。在 PHP 中,可以使用 $_COOKIE 数组来获取 Cookie 中的数值。例如:

总结

通过以上介绍,我们了解了在 PHP 中如何获取不同方式传递的数值。无论是通过 URL、表单、Session 还是 Cookie,都有相应的方法来获取这些传值。在实际开发中,根据情况选择合适的方式来获取传值,可以更加灵活和高效地处理数据。

七、php获取json值

PHP获取JSON值的方法

在Web开发中, JSON(JavaScript Object Notation)是一种常用的数据格式,它与PHP结合使用可以帮助开发人员实现数据交换和处理。在本文中,我们将重点讨论如何在PHP中获取JSON值的方法,以帮助您更好地利用这一强大的数据格式。

了解JSON

首先,让我们简要了解一下JSON。JSON是一种轻量级的数据交换格式,具有易读性和良好的结构化特性。它由键值对组成,可以包含对象和数组,非常适合用于表示复杂的数据结构。

PHP中操作JSON的函数

PHP提供了丰富的函数来操作JSON数据,其中最常用的是json_decodejson_encode函数。

使用json_decode函数获取JSON值

json_decode函数用于将JSON字符串解码为PHP变量。当您需要从一个JSON字符串中获取特定的值时,可以使用这个函数来实现。

以下是一个简单的示例,展示了如何使用json_decode函数获取JSON值:

$jsonString = '{"name": "John", "age": 30, "city": "New York"}'; $data = json_decode($jsonString); $name = $data->name; $age = $data->age; $city = $data->city;

在这个例子中,我们首先定义了一个JSON字符串$jsonString,然后使用json_decode函数将其解码为PHP变量$data。接着,我们就可以通过访问$data的属性来获取JSON中的值。

处理JSON中的数组

当JSON中包含数组时,我们也可以通过json_decode函数来处理。以下是一个示例,展示如何获取JSON数组中的值:


  $jsonString = '[{"name": "Alice", "age": 25}, {"name": "Bob", "age": 28}]';
  $data = json_decode($jsonString);
  
  foreach($data as $item) {
    $name = $item->name;
    $age = $item->age;
    // 进行进一步处理
  }
  

在这个例子中,$jsonString包含了一个包含两个对象的数组。我们通过遍历$data数组来获取每个对象中的值。

使用json_encode函数处理JSON

除了从JSON中获取值外,您还可以使用json_encode函数将PHP变量编码为JSON字符串。这在需要将数据发送到前端或其他系统时非常有用。

以下是一个示例,展示如何使用json_encode函数将PHP数组转换为JSON字符串:


  $data = array("name" => "Emily", "age" => 27, "city" => "London");
  $jsonString = json_encode($data);
  

在这个示例中,我们定义了一个PHP数组$data,然后使用json_encode函数将其编码为JSON字符串$jsonString

结语

通过本文的介绍,您现在应该了解如何在PHP中获取JSON值了。使用json_decodejson_encode函数,您可以轻松地处理JSON数据,从而实现更高效的数据交换和处理。希望本文对您有所帮助,谢谢阅读!

八、php 获取0值

在编写 PHP 代码的过程中,经常会遇到需要获取变量值的情况。其中,获取变量值为 0 的需求是比较常见且重要的一种情况。本文将针对 PHP 中获取变量值为 0 的问题展开讨论,探讨不同情况下的解决方案。

PHP 中获取变量值为 0 的问题

在 PHP 中,有时我们需要获取变量的值,然后根据这个值来进行相应的逻辑判断和处理。然而,当变量的值为 0 时,可能会引发一些特殊的情况,需要我们特别注意。

例如,在进行数值运算或比较时,如果遇到变量值为 0 的情况,可能会导致程序逻辑出现错误。因此,了解如何正确获取变量值为 0 是编写健壮 PHP 代码的重要一环。

解决方法

针对 PHP 中获取变量值为 0 的情况,可以采取以下几种解决方法:

  • 使用严格比较运算符===
  • 使用intval()函数转换数值
  • 使用filter_var()函数验证数值

使用严格比较运算符===

在 PHP 中,使用严格比较运算符===可以确保比较的两个值不仅在数值上相等,而且类型也相等。这在处理变量值为 0 的情况时特别有用。

例如,下面的代码演示了如何使用===运算符比较变量值为 0 的情况:

九、php 获取token值

在PHP编程中,获取token值是一个常见且重要的操作。在许多Web应用程序和API集成中,使用token来验证用户的身份和授权访问是至关重要的。本文将重点介绍在PHP环境下如何获取token值的几种方法,以帮助开发人员更好地理解和应用这一技术。

使用PHP获取token值的方法

在PHP中,获取token值的方法通常可以分为以下几种:

  • 使用HTTP请求
  • 使用PHP扩展库
  • 使用第三方服务

通过HTTP请求获取token值

一种常见的方式是通过HTTP请求来获取token值。开发人员可以利用PHP中的curl或者其他HTTP请求库来向服务器发起请求并获取返回的token值。这种方法通常适用于需要访问外部API或服务的情况。

使用PHP扩展库获取token值

PHP提供了许多扩展库,其中一些库专门用于处理身份验证和授权问题。开发人员可以使用这些库来获取token值,并在应用程序中进行验证和授权操作。例如,可以使用OAuth扩展库来实现OAuth授权,从而获取访问令牌(access token)。

借助第三方服务获取token值

除了自行处理token值的获取外,开发人员还可以借助第三方服务来简化这一过程。许多身份验证和授权服务提供商(如Auth0、Firebase等)都提供了API,开发人员可以通过调用这些API来获取token值。这种方式通常适用于需要快速集成授权功能的场景。

总的来说,无论是通过HTTP请求、PHP扩展库还是第三方服务,获取token值都是现代Web开发中不可或缺的一环。开发人员应根据自身项目的需求和特点选择合适的方法,并遵循最佳实践来确保安全性和稳定性。

十、jquery radio 值 选中

jQuery 如何获取和设置单选框的值并选中

单选框是网页表单中常见的元素之一,通过使用jQuery,可以轻松地获取和设置单选框的值,并实现选中效果。本文将介绍如何利用jQuery操作单选框的值并使其选中,让您更好地控制表单数据的交互。无论您是初学者还是有一定经验的前端开发者,本文都将为您提供详细的指导和实用的代码示例。

首先,让我们来看一下如何使用jQuery获取单选框的值。要获取单选框的值,可以通过以下代码实现:

$('input:radio[name=radioName]:checked').val();

上面的代码中,radioName 是单选框的名称,通过选择器找到被选中的单选框,并使用 val() 函数获取其值。这样就可以获取到用户选择的单选框的值了。

接下来,我们来看一下如何使用jQuery设置单选框的值并选中。要设置单选框的值并使其选中,可以通过以下代码实现:


$('input:radio[name=radioName][value=desiredValue]').prop('checked', true);
  

在上面的代码中,radioName 是单选框的名称,desiredValue 是您想要选中的值。通过选择器找到对应的单选框,并使用 prop('checked', true) 将其选中。这样就可以动态设置单选框的值并实现选中效果了。

如果您需要在特定情况下根据用户操作来获取和设置单选框的值,可以通过绑定事件来实现。例如,当用户点击某个按钮时,将特定的单选框设置为选中状态,代码示例如下:


$('#submitButton').click(function() {
  $('input:radio[name=radioName][value=desiredValue]').prop('checked', true);
});
  

在以上代码中,submitButton 是触发事件的按钮的ID,当用户点击按钮时,将特定的单选框设置为选中状态。这样就可以根据用户操作动态地设置单选框的值并实现选中效果了。

总的来说,通过使用jQuery,您可以方便地获取和设置单选框的值,并实现选中效果。无论是简单的表单页面还是复杂的交互功能,掌握这些操作单选框的技巧都将有助于您更好地处理表单数据。希望本文对您有所帮助,如有任何疑问或建议,请随时与我们联系。

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
用户名: 验证码:点击我更换图片

网站地图 (共30个专题236875篇文章)

返回首页